"Jaws" by Nigel Andrews
This is a guide to the suspenseful 1970s film "Jaws", about the man-eating shark who terrifies the peaceful community of Amity Island. Police Chief Brody has to kill the shark assisted only by a marine biologist and a drunken shark expert. Roy Schneider and Richard Dryfuss starred in the film.
Nigel Andrews is the film critic of the Financial Times and the author of True Myths: The Life and Times of Arnold Schwarzenegger, Birch Lane Press, 1996. After graduating from Cambridge University he worked at the British Film Institute as an editor on the Cinema One book series and was a frequent writer for Sight and Sound and the Monthly Film Bulletin. He has also broadcast regularly for BBC Radio, writing and presenting programmes on the arts and cinema. In 1985 he was named Critic of the Year in the British Press Awards.
